House Edge in Online Roulette Canada
When playing online roulette in Canada, it’s important to understand the house edge. The house edge refers to the advantage that the casino has over the player in a game. In online roulette, the house edge can vary depending on the variant of the game being played. For example, European roulette has a lower house edge compared to American roulette due to the presence of a single zero on the wheel.
Payouts in Online Roulette Canada
The payouts in online roulette in Canada can also vary depending on the type of bet placed. For example, betting on a single number (straight bet) has a higher payout compared to betting on red or black (even money bet).
